Follow up on this for anyone wishing to renew a Philippine passport. The Embassy is now open for appointments only, we booked online and chose the time and day from available slots. We managed to book a parking space near Trafalgar Square and walked about 200m to the Embassy. I was not allowed to enter and my wife was required to wear a mask, all the staff were using PPE. The whole process took about 20 minutes and not a rioter in sight! I was expecting a nightmare so it was a pleasant surprise.
Used a company online to book the parking space £11.50 for three hours. Plus congestion charge. Could have been worse and solved our problem.
